From the back cover: Easy to raise, manageable, and
increasingly affordable, llamas have become a popular
choice for backyard livestock. Uses for these
versatile animals include packing, protecting other
livestock, and producing fleece and organic
fertilizer. Written for both the novice and
experienced owner, this complete guide covers it all:
* Buying your first llama * Building your herd *
Breeding, birthing and herd management * Feeding and
facilities *
Health care and first aid * Using llamas as guardian
and expedition animals

A classic natural pet-care book from two celebrated veterinary
specialists in chemical-free nutrition, treatment, and natural
healing for pets, Dr. Pitcairn's Complete Guide to Natural Health
for Dogs & Cats offers valuable natural and holistic advice on a
host of pet topics, including, but not limited to, diet, exercise,
environment, coping with a pet's death, and how to care for a sick
animal. In addition to their thorough discussion of the above,
Richard Pitcairn, D.V.M., and his wife, Susan Hubble Pitcairn, M.S.,
offer a comprehensive "quick reference" section on animal
illnesses, organized alphabetically and including a brief
description of each illness, preventative measures that
may be taken, and holistic and natural treatment options for both
dogs and cats--treatments that should always be discussed with one's
vet before being used. Occasional line drawings, informative graphs,
and the Pitcairn's intelligent prose make this guide a must-have for
pet owners interested in a natural lifestyle for their pets.
